Hybrid and Energy Efficiency in Vehicles
Understanding the difference between full electric and hybrid electric conversion kits is crucial for vintage vehicle owners. Full electric kits completely replace the combustion engine, while hybrid systems maintain a gasoline engine alongside electric power. Each option offers unique advantages; for instance, hybrid systems provide greater range due to the dual power sources, making them particularly appealing for longer drives.Energy efficiency ratings vary widely among electric conversion kits.
Many modern kits are designed to maximize range and efficiency, enabling vintage vehicles to achieve performance levels comparable to new electric cars. Owners should consider these ratings when selecting a conversion kit to ensure optimal performance.

Automotive Repairs for Converted Electric Vehicles
Common repairs required for vintage electric conversions often include battery maintenance, wiring checks, and software updates for the electric components. Because these vehicles integrate both classic and modern technology, specialized knowledge is essential for effective maintenance. Owners should seek out mechanics familiar with both classic cars and electric systems to ensure proper care.Sourcing parts for electric conversion repairs can pose challenges, especially for rare vintage models.
However, a growing network of suppliers specializing in electric vehicle parts has emerged, making it easier for owners to find what they need. Building relationships within this community can also provide valuable insights and support for ongoing vehicle maintenance.
SUVs, Trucks, Vans, and Their Electric Conversion Potential
The feasibility of converting larger vehicles like SUVs and trucks to electric is gaining traction as technology advances. These conversions present unique challenges, such as increased weight and power requirements, but many vintage vans and trucks have shown remarkable potential for electric transformation. Popular models like the Chevrolet Suburban and Volkswagen Type 2 are prime examples of vehicles that are not only suitable for electric conversion but also appeal to a wide audience eager for sustainable options.Market trends indicate a growing interest in restored electric trucks, particularly as consumers prioritize eco-friendliness alongside utility.
This trend reflects a broader movement towards sustainable practices in transportation, making electric conversions not just a novelty but a viable choice for everyday use.

Popular Questions
What are restored vintage electric conversion kits?
They are kits designed to convert classic vehicles into electric-powered ones, preserving their vintage aesthetics while enhancing performance and sustainability.
How does converting a classic car to electric benefit the environment?
It reduces greenhouse gas emissions and reliance on fossil fuels, contributing to a cleaner and more sustainable future.
Can any classic car be converted to electric?
Most classic cars can be converted, but the feasibility depends on factors like the vehicle’s structure and weight.
What is the cost range for electric conversion kits?
The cost varies widely based on the kit and vehicle, typically ranging from a few thousand to tens of thousands of dollars.
Are there any maintenance requirements for electric conversions?
Yes, they require specific maintenance, especially regarding the battery and electrical systems, which may differ from traditional vehicles.
